Error in console [access] This app has crashed because it attempted to access privacy-sensitive data without a usage description. The app's Info.plist must contain an NSCameraUsageDescription key with a string value explaining to the user how the app uses this data.

I Solved This issue:- Go to info.plist - Your Xcode bundle Click the "+" and go down the resulting list until you see "Privacy - Camera Usage Description". Add this item to by clicking it inside that list.
Format ..-Info.Plist Key :- Privacy - Camera Usage Description Type :- string Value :- empty - Don't enter anything
Just clean xcode project and run it ... it's worked for me.
